Clever-Excel-Forum

Normale Version: Excel Formel Leerzeichen nur am Anfang einer Zelle entfernen
Du siehst gerade eine vereinfachte Darstellung unserer Inhalte. Normale Ansicht mit richtiger Formatierung.
Hallo Zusammen,

ich suche eine Excel Formel um folgendes Problem zu lösen:

Ich möchte die Leerzeichen am Anfang einer Zelle entfernen, die anderen Leerzeichen sollen aber bestehen bleiben (darum funktioniert =glätten() nicht). Bei jeden Datensatz ist die Anzahl der Leerzeichen am Zellanfang unterschiedlich. Hier mein Beispiel (x steht für Leerzeichen):

Ausgangsdaten

A1: xxxxxxxMariusxxxxxxxxxxxxMüllerxxxxx
A2: xxxOttoxxxxxNormalo
A3: xxxxxxEvaxxxxxxxxxxxxMeierxxxx
usw.


Gewünschtes Ergebnis
B1: MariusxxxxxxxxxxxxMüllerxxxxx
B2: OttoxxxxxNormalo
B3: EvaxxxxxxxxxxxxMeierxxxx
usw.

Wenn mir hier jemand weiterhelfen könnte, wäre das super :)

Viele Grüße
Kento
Hi,

wer sagt, dass Glätten nicht funktioniert? 


=GLÄTTEN(A1)

LG
Alexandra
Hi Alexandra,


Zitat:die anderen Leerzeichen sollen aber bestehen bleiben (darum funktioniert =glätten() nicht)

deshalb. Glätten entfernt auch die unzähligen Leerzeichen zwischen den Texten, wobei sich mir aber nicht die Sinnhaftigkeit der Leerzeichen erschließt.
Hi Günter,

stimmt, du hast recht, es sind mehrere Leerzeichen! :)

LG
Alexandra
Hallo Kento,

per benutzdefinierter (VBA-)Funktion z.B. so:

Code:
Public Function LVW(Zelle As Range)
  LVW = LTRIM(Zelle.Value)
End Function

In der Zelle B1 dann die Formel =lvw(A1) eintragen.

Gruß Uwe
Sorry dass ich mich jetzt erst zurück melde (hab grad viel um die Ohren)...
VBA funktioniert!!! Yeeeaah! Vielen vielen Dank Uwe! Großartig! Und dann antworten alle so schnell.
Echt super, ich wünsch euch was ihr Lieben! LG Kento